The Climate and Development Knowledge Network (CDKN) aims to help decision-makers in developing countries design and deliver climate compatible development. CDKN does this by providing demand-led research and technical assistance, and channelling the best available knowledge on climate change and development to support policy processes at the country level. We see the media as an important player in these processes. The mass media reach broader audiences, shaping public debates and norms around environment and development issues. By having such reach and influence, the media is critical in creating a supportive context for visionary policies that integrate climate change and development, and for their implementation. CDKN wishes to commission a number of sets of written and/or audio content each from several media agencies or media channels with international reach, to provide ongoing coverage on a wide range of climate change and development issues.
